- the invention relates to a device for securing the lid of a can, in particular a paint can, against undesired opening, with a surface at the head end and a circumferential side wall, which forms a hollow body and consists of two sections of different diameters, and with a distance from the head end of the device and on the inside of the first portion of the side wall.
- Cans, especially lacquer cans are often with a lid, such as a press-in cover.
- a lid such as a press-in cover.
- cans with an opening of more than 70 mm need to be secured against undesired opening during transport.
- Such safety devices previously consisted of a type of bracket that can be fixed to the can with the aid of two brackets and protects the can lid from an undesired opening by holding it down.
- brackets for fixing the bracket, which increases the cost of manufacturing the cans.
- Stacking of the cans is also excluded when using such hangers.
- Devices for securing the lid of a can which act as a cap-like hold-down device on the can closed with the lid be put on.
- Such cap-like hold-downs have a surface at the head end and are provided with a circumferential side wall, which forms a hollow body and consists of two sections of different diameters, and with a projection arranged at a distance from the head end and on the inside of the first section of the side wall.
- Such a device is described in German utility model G 87 08 272.1. With such a device, after the lid has been applied to a can, it can be difficult and time-consuming to remove the device for securing the lid from the can.
- the invention has for its object to provide a device for securing the lid of a can, in particular paint can, which prevents unwanted opening of the can, especially during transport, when used improperly, but at the same time is characterized by easy handling, so that it lends itself to use between individual phases of use of the paint can, but without quickly losing its effectiveness through repeated use.
- a device of the type mentioned which is a cap-like hold-down device, in that the projection arranged on the inside of the first section of the side wall is only largely circumferential, ie that its beginning in the circumferential direction in a distance to the end is arranged.
- the projection is thus not in the form of a closed circumferential ring, but is interrupted at least once. It can also consist of several sections, for example two, four or eight sections.
- the device for securing the lid of a can in particular paint can, has a largely circumferential projection, the beginning of which is arranged at a distance from the end in the circumferential direction, a removal of the can is made possible without this Excessive effort is required, since in the one or more gaps that arise between the beginning and end or between the sections of the projection, an auxiliary tool that is required anyway for opening the can, such as a screwdriver can be inserted, with the help of which the securing device can be easily removed from the can without the risk of destroying the securing device.
- the projection consists of two sections, each beginning at a distance from the central axis of the device and ending at a distance from the central axis, this represents a particularly advantageous embodiment of the securing device according to the invention.
- the lead consists of four or more, e.g. Eight sections, each beginning at a distance from one of the two center lines and ending at a distance from the second center line arranged perpendicularly thereto, thus create a securing device which enables an aid, such as e.g. to insert a screwdriver into a plurality of gaps provided for receiving such an aid in order to detach the securing device from the socket without any particular effort.
- an aid such as e.g. to insert a screwdriver into a plurality of gaps provided for receiving such an aid in order to detach the securing device from the socket without any particular effort.
- the surface at the head end of the device can be designed in a ring shape and can be provided with one or more webs. This results in a material saving compared to a completely closed surface.
- the device can be equipped with a so-called stacking bead.
- This is one on the top of the surface at the head end vertically arranged ring, which engages in the usual indentation of the can bottom of the can to be stacked above and enables non-slip stacking.
- the ring can have a smaller outside and inside diameter than the entire device. However, its outside diameter can also match the outside diameter of the device, ie the ring can be designed as an extension of the side wall.
- the ring can be continuous, it can also have notches on the inside or it can have interruptions. Notches or interruptions can only mechanically damage certain areas of the ring in the event of an impact load, so that the functionality of the ring is retained.
- the stacking bead also serves as shock or fall protection. This stacking bead also serves to stabilize the securing device according to the invention.
- the device according to the invention has a plurality of cam-shaped elevations (cams) on the surface facing the can lid to be secured at the head end.
- cams are arranged so that they lie on the lid provided on the edge of the lid when pressed and press this onto the inner edge of the can.
- the cams are therefore preferably formed on a circular path that runs on the surface at the head end of the device at a distance from the circumferential side wall. The distance from the peripheral side wall is chosen so that the cams press on the edge of the lid of the lid to be secured.
- the cams are formed individually and not as a circumferential surface in order to enable better removal or opening of the device. Several, for example four, six or eight cams can lie on the circular orbit.
- the design of the securing device makes it possible to remove it from the can to be secured without having to exert increased force, so that damage to the securing device is effectively counteracted and repeated use of the securing device is made possible due to the simple and safe handling.
- the device according to the invention can consist of different materials, in particular plastics.
- plastics examples include polyethylene and polypropylene.
- polyethylene the necessary strength and good flexibility for attachment and removal to and from the can are achieved.
- Polypropylene ensures that the device functions properly.
- the device 1 is designed as a circular, cap-like hold-down device and has at its head end a ring 3 that partially closes the ring, on the outer edge (see FIG. 2) of which a side wall 4 forming a hollow body is arranged all around.
- the ring 3 is arranged coaxially to the center point 2 of the device 1 and ends with its inner edge pointing towards the center point at a distance from the outside, which in the present exemplary embodiment is approximately 12.5 mm.
- a smaller or larger distance from the inner edge is also conceivable, or an overall closed surface of the head end.
- the ring 3 has, in its inner diameter, four crosswise arranged, respectively opposite sections of the inside of the ring which connect to one another and are integrally formed with it, webs 5 which are arranged at a distance of 90 ° from one another and whose ends facing the ring 3 are tapered with a radius the ring 3 or its inner diameter are connected.
- the number of webs 5 can also be more or less than 4, depending on the can size.
- the inner ends of the ribs 5 converge in a circular center 6, which is also arranged co-axially with the center 2 of the device 1.
- the circumferential side wall 4 consists of two sections 7, 8 of different diameters and different heights, the first section 7 adjoining the ring 3 of the head end and taking up a little more than 2/3 of the wall height having an 8 small diameter compared to the second section having.
- the wall section adjoining the ring 3 has, at about half its wall height, an inward-facing circumferential projection 9, which is interrupted co-axially to the center lines and whose inside dimension is less than the diameter of the first section and its side 10 facing the ring 3 just formed, is arranged parallel to the ring 3.
- the side of the projection 9 facing away from the ring 3 is designed as a bevel 11, which drops at the edge forming the inside diameter of the projection 9 towards the end of the end of the first wall section 7 facing away from the ring 3 such that here the inside diameter of the first section 7 and the inside diameter of the slope 11 of the projection 9 starting here is identical.
- the second section 8 of the side wall 4 has a larger diameter than the first section 7 and begins on the side of the ring 3 facing away from the ring Projection 9 or at the end of the first section 7 facing away from the ring 3 and ends at a distance from this.
- the projection 9 is interrupted co-axially to the center lines of the device 1 or the webs 5, i.e. it begins and ends at a distance from the center lines 12, shown in FIGS. 2 and 1.
- the side of the ring 3 of the hold-down device 1 facing away from the side wall 4 is provided with a rib-shaped second ring 13, as shown in FIG. 2, which, as shown in FIG. 1, concentrically runs circumferentially at a distance from the outer edge of the horizontally arranged ring 3 is arranged. Furthermore, the ring 13 is vertical, i.e. at an angle of 90 ° to the ring 3.
- Both the horizontally arranged ring 3 and the webs 5, the center 6, the side wall 4 and the projection 9 are formed in one piece.
- the second section 8 of the side wall 4 each at least partially comprising the first section 7 of the side wall 4 of the hold-down device 1 underneath and the surface 3 of the head end designed as a ring and the outer surface edge of the side facing away from the side wall 4 of the ring 13 of the lower holding-down device 1 engages with the underside of the projection 9 or the bevels 11 of the projection 9 of the holding-down device 1 located above it, so that a large number of devices are stacked non-slip on top of one another can be.
- cap-shaped hold-down device 1 While the cap-shaped hold-down device 1 is in use, as shown in FIG. 3, it is placed on the head end of a can and a conventional lid.
- the projection 7 over that at the head end of the box 14 located flare 15 pressed so that first the slope 11 slides along the flare 15 so that the flat end 10 of the projection 9 facing the head end of the hold-down device 1 comes into engagement with the underside of the flare 15 and the hold-down device 1 firmly on the can 14 sits.
- these can also be stacked one above the other in connection with the hold-down device 1, the ring 13 arranged vertically on the hold-down device 1 in the provided or customary recess 17 of the can bottom (as shown in FIG. 14) of the can to be stacked above it engages and so a non-slip storage or stacking of cans is guaranteed.
- FIG. 4 shows an example of an embodiment of the device according to the invention, which has eight webs 5. Also shown in this embodiment are cams 18 which, as can also be seen from FIGS. 5 and 6, which represent a section or partial section of FIG. 4, are arranged such that they extend inwards from the surface at the head end. You can press on the edge of the lid of the lid placed on the can and press it on the inner edge of the can. A cam 18 is also shown which can be pressed or pressed onto the center of the can lid.
- FIG. 1 to explain the embodiment in FIGS. 4, 5 and 6.
- the numbering of the side wall 4, the projection 9 and the ring 13 (stacking bead) in FIG. 6 corresponds to the numbering in FIG. 2.
- the ring 13 is shown spaced from the side wall, i.e. its outer and inner diameters are less than the overall diameter of the device. However, the ring 13 can also be shifted to the outer edge, so that it is designed as an extension of the side wall 4.
